Ladda ner presentationen
Presentation laddar. Vänta.
1
Genetiska algoritmer – Evolution i en digital värld.
Primus Nyxén, Kim Jansson Akademin för innovation, design och teknik Mälardalens högskola
2
Innehåll Introduktion Historia Teknik Användning
Inflytande från biologin Sammanfattning
3
Genetiska algoritmer Simulerar evolution och naturligt urval
Är en typ av sökalgoritm Söker efter lösningar på problem Har blivit en viktig del inom AI
4
Historia 1800-talet Darwin Mendel 1900-talet Genetik Datavetenskap
5
Teknik Algoritmen Skapa population Tilldela Fitness
Skapa ny population: Välj individer för parning Ersätt två individer med två barn Mutation Hitta bästa individ, spara Börja om
6
Val av individer Flera olika metoder Roulette wheel selection
Slump med individuell sannolikhet Väljer inte nödvändigtvis den bästa
7
Parning och mutation Två binära strängar kombineras Två ny individer
Mutering Välj en bit i strängen Invertera
8
Användning Förbättring av andra algoritmer Svårt att bara använda GA
Snabbare lösningar Bättre resultat Svårt att bara använda GA Traveling salesman problem Dechiffrering
9
Inflytande från biologin
Darwin & Mendel Grundpelarna till genetiska algoritmer
10
Inflytande från biologin
Charles Darwin ( ) Om arternas uppkomst Den moderna evolutionsteorin Naturligt urval
11
Inflytande från biologin
Gregor Mendel ( ) Arbetade med genetik och arvsanlag Bevisade följande: Genetiska särdrag är nedärvda från någon av föräldrarna Gener kan inte “blandas”, som tidigare trotts Honor och hanar bidrar lika mycket till avkommans gener Särdrag som skaffats under livstiden kan inte nedärvas Lade grunden till modern genetik
12
Inflytande från biologin
Jean-Baptiste Lamarck ( ) Grundare till “Lamarkism” Hävdade att en individs genetiska uppsättning kunde ändras under livstiden. Teorin motbevisades, men kunde senare utnyttjas inom GA.
13
Inflytande från biologin
James Mark Baldwin ( ) Lade grunden till uttrycket “Baldwin-effekten” Baldwin-effekten I kort: En grupp individer som har möjlighet att lära och anpassa under sin livstid kommer att ha fördel i det naturliga urvalet, och evolutionen kommer därför ha ökad takt för denna grupp. Baldwin-effekten kan med fördel användas i GA.
14
Sammanfattning Genetiska algoritmer kan vara effektiva i kombination med annan teknik Begränsat eget användningsområde Löser ofta en liten del av ett större problem Hittar adekvata lösningar på mindre problem
15
Tack för oss!
Liknande presentationer
© 2024 SlidePlayer.se Inc.
All rights reserved.